CVE-2026-64355 Detail

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: bpf: Reject fragmented frames in devmap Devmap broadcast redirects clone the packet for all but the last destination. For native XDP, that clone path copies only the linear xdp_frame data, while fragmented frames keep skb_shared_info in tailroom outside the linear area. Cloning such a frame leaves XDP_FLAGS_HAS_FRAGS set but without valid frag metadata, and the later free path can interpret uninitialized tail data as skb_shared_info, leading to an out-of-bounds access during frame return. Reject fragmented native XDP frames in dev_map_enqueue_clone(). Add the same restriction to the generic XDP clone path in dev_map_redirect_clone(). Generic XDP represents fragmented packets as nonlinear skbs, and rejecting them here keeps clone-based broadcast support aligned between native and generic XDP.
